From its birth, hip hop culture has been majorly influential for a lot of fashion trends. One of the most recognizable is the sporting of chains .Both silver and gold chains are worn by rap and hip hop artists to also show off their wealth, my cover artists will be wearing a chain for this specific reason. Since most rappers come from low to middle income upbringings, it also represents their rise to success, especially if all odds were against them prior to their careers. However these beautiful symbols of success not only portray the fact that they have money, but alos represent literal chaining,a practice that was done during the times of slavery. They wear chains as a symbol of paying homage in an ironic twist, howver, they put themselves in the the very chains that their                               ancestors worked so hard to get out of.

title block analysis







 ‘The source’ magazine focusses on hip hop and rap music, the style of text used for the masthead connotes this well as it is bright, bold & urban, and the colours of the text also contrast with the background. The use of the hand wrapped around a microphone as a logo also supports the suggestion that the magazine’s genre is mainly hip-hop and rap. This is because hand held microphones are most commonly associated with hip hop and rap freestyles. The microphone embedded within the logo is good for advertisement as it allows the source to stand out from other magazine competitors, as the logo is eye catching and unique.
